Masonry repair services involve the assessment, restoration, and reinforcement of existing masonry structures such as brickwork, stonework, and concrete. These services typically address issues like cracks, spalling, deterioration, and structural instability that can compromise the integrity and appearance of masonry elements. Skilled contractors utilize specialized techniques to repair or replace damaged sections, ensuring that the original aesthetic and structural function of the masonry are preserved or restored. Proper repair work can help extend the lifespan of masonry features and prevent further deterioration over time.

Many common problems that masonry repair services help resolve include cracking due to settling or temperature changes, water infiltration leading to freeze-thaw damage, and general wear from exposure to the elements. Over time, mortar joints may weaken or deteriorate, causing loose or falling bricks or stones. Repairing these issues not only maintains the safety of the property but also helps uphold its visual appeal. Addressing masonry problems early can prevent more costly repairs in the future and preserve the structural integrity of the building or landscape feature.

Masonry repair services are frequently utilized on a variety of property types, including residential homes, commercial buildings, historical structures, and public landmarks. Residential properties often require masonry repairs for chimneys, foundations, retaining walls, or decorative facades. Commercial properties may need repairs on storefronts, parking structures, or exterior walls that are exposed to heavy use and weathering. Additionally, historic buildings and landmarks often depend on specialized masonry restoration techniques to maintain their original character while ensuring safety and stability.

The overview below groups typical Masonry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Columbia, SC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- Masonry repair services typically range from $500 to $3,000 depending on the extent of damage. For example, small cracks may cost around $500 to fix, while larger structural issues could be closer to $3,000.

Material Expenses - The cost of materials for masonry repair varies, with common expenses between $200 and $1,500. This includes mortar, bricks, or stone, which can influence the overall project price.

Labor Fees - Labor costs for masonry repairs generally fall between $50 and $150 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the project's size and complexity, with larger jobs requiring more hours.

Project Factors - Factors such as accessibility, type of masonry, and extent of damage can impact costs significantly. Minor repairs might be on the lower end, while extensive restoration projects tend to be more costly.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of masonry repair services are commonly available? Masonry repair services typically include fixing cracks, repointing mortar joints, restoring damaged bricks or stones, and addressing structural issues in existing masonry structures.

How can I tell if my masonry needs repair? Signs that masonry may require repair include visible cracks, crumbling mortar, loose or missing bricks, and water infiltration or staining around masonry surfaces.

What are the benefits of professional masonry repair? Professional masonry repair can help preserve the structural integrity, improve appearance, and extend the lifespan of masonry features in residential or commercial properties.

Are there different repair methods for various types of masonry? Yes, repair methods vary depending on the material, such as brick, stone, or concrete, and can include repointing, patching, or replacing damaged sections to match existing materials.
